Ravens place OLB Pernell McPhee on reserve/COVID-19 list, joining 6 others

The Ravens placed outside linebacker Pernell McPhee on the reserve/COVID-19 list on Tuesday, a day after he was activated from the injured reserve.

McPhee is the Ravens’ seventh active player on the reserve/COVID-19 list, joining outside linebacker Justin Houston, wide receiver Sammy Watkins, safety Chuck Clark, center Trystan Colon, and cornerbacks Jimmy Smith and Chris Westry. Houston was added to the list on Monday.

If Houston and McPhee are unable to play Sunday against the Cincinnati Bengals, the Ravens would have only Tyus Bowser, Jaylon Ferguson and Odafe Oweh available at outside linebacker. Inside linebacker Malik Harrison also has some experience on the edge.

Under the NFL’s COVID protocols, McPhee and Houston could come off the list before Sunday’s game against the Bengals game if they are vaccinated and test negative for the virus twice. If they tested positive and are not vaccinated, both players would have to isolate for at least 10 days.

McPhee, who has played nine games this season, is returning from minor knee surgery. He hasn’t played since the Ravens’ 22-10 loss to the Miami Dolphins in Week 10.

The Ravens also signed veteran cornerback Daryl Worley to the practice squad to help support an injury-depleted secondary. Worley, a former third-round pick in 2016, has played for six different teams and made 54 starts in his six-year NFL career.
